Kevin Durant, Draymond Green Reportedly 'Drunk' During Gold Medal Celebration

A couple of videos of men's basketball players celebrating their recent victory over France to win gold at the Olympics in Tokyo earlier this month have surfaced.

Two players from Team USA, Kevin Durant and Draymond Green, both appear to be intoxicated in the videos.

The videos feature the two on the team bus having a celebration after the gold medal win, and Green even posted the videos on Instagram.

While Green and Durant are the two biggest names featured in the videos, Devin Booker and Damian Lillard can also be seen enjoying the fruits of their labor.










The players in the video can be seen drinking LeBron James’ Lobos Tequila, and Durant and Green both give love to their fellow NBA baller in the video.

"Hey Bron, hey Bron, Bron Bron," Durant stated in one of the videos. "We got Lobos in the cup!"

"Just a bunch of gold medalists man," Green said in the video. "And Lobos in the cup."

One player who commented in the video as well is Boston Celtics star Jayson Tatum, who says that Green and Durant are 'drunk' on the bus.

That didn't stop James' company from retweeting the video of Team USA celebrating, and James himself congratulated his fellow players.
